Ambassador of Thailand attends the 8th ASEAN Connectivity Forum on behalf of the ASEAN Committee in Seoul

On 19 January 2021, Ms. Rommanee Kananurak, Ambassador of Thailand to the Republic of Korea attended the 8th ASEAN Connectivity Forum, organized by the ASEAN-Korea Centre with support from the Ministry of Foreign Affairs of the Republic of Korea, the ASEAN Secretariat, and the Construction Association of Korea. The Forum aimed to promote the ROK’s engagement in ASEAN connectivity and infrastructure development projects, and consisted of participants from the public and private sectors as well as organizations specialized in infrastructure and connectivity in the Republic of Korea.
 
Ambassador Rommanee delivered congratulatory remarks at the opening of the Forum in her capacity as Chair of the ASEAN Committee in Seoul. She emphasized the importance of strengthening cooperation between ASEAN and the ROK on enhancing connectivity, including infrastructure and smart cities development, digital connectivity, and facilitating business travel in order to reinvigorate the region’s supply chain, and cooperation under the Master Plan on ASEAN Connectivity 2025 (MPAC 2025) and the New Southern Policy Plus Strategy, so that both sides can together achieve economic recovery and prepare for the Post-COVID-19 Era. Other sessions in the Forum included a panel discussion and project presentations on transport, energy, and smart cities from representatives of ASEAN member states.
